Chapter Seven: The Battle
The Mayor can back a few hours after I finished preparing. He stood there staring at me for a second which creeped me out but we can ignore that.
“Dan is luring the Nether Bear over as I speak,” he said looking around, “You don’t seem to have prepared at all”
‘I have you just can’t see i-’ before I could finish my sentence Nathan came running in with a 20-foot bear following him. I grabbed him and threw him out of the way since he was about to step on the cage. I didn’t expect the bear to be so fast though and flexible though. It stopped and jumped at him faster than I could move the cage.
What did Nathan do to make it so angry at him? I made a wall of roots supported by more roots. I even put a bit of Earth Magic into it since I wasn’t expecting this thing to hold up against a 20-foot bear. It did hold up to 2 strikes though, this was enough time for me to get Nathan out of the way and the Mayor to charge up his attack. He had a red sword with Fire Magic blazing around it in a firey tornado.
“Phoenix Claw” he yelled as he stabbed forward into the bear's left back leg. It made a deep slash on its leg. The fire didn’t do any extra damage since the bear had a strong Fire Affinity. The sword on the other hand was very sharp since it could cut a Low Tier Magic Beast.
I wasn’t gonna just sit back though, I sent a few leaves infused with [Spear Projections] making them flying spears. I added a little Fire Magic making the tips on fire and with the Wind Magic there to help the fire grow I made a new skill called [Spear Rain]. I shot about 35 of them at the bear but only 12 hits. They were stuck into the bear and wouldn’t come out.

The bear ran towards the Mayor at an insane speed and before any of us could move it threw the Mayor straight into me. I did cushion the landing by using roots with leaves on top. I think he broke a rib or two but I didn’t have time to care since the bear was charging straight at us again. I used Water Magic to make the ground wet to slow it down and grew some roots to try and trip it. It didn’t work since the bear went straight through all of it even ripping a few roots out.
It wasn’t in the cage yet and I couldn’t move it fast enough to get the bear in the cage right now. I don’t even know if the cage could hold any more. I tried sending a root from behind it that stabbed into the wound that the Mayor had made. It connected and I finally had something to use that could help us. I sent the paralyzing poison into the bear and it took a few secs to kick in but the bear started to slow down. It didn’t completely stop the bear but it did slow it down enough for me to use [Root Prison] on it. The root that was sending in poison split in two and a Mana sucking root started draining the bear's strength.
I could finally see a way to win. I started moving the cage since now the bear was at a walking speed which gave me more than enough time to move the cage in front of it. I moved the cage in front of the bear and I was ready to finally end this. Then the bear as if seemingly sensing the danger turned berserk. It ripped the roots in its body out and ran at Nathan instead of us.

Then I saw why it went berserk, Nathan was holding its baby. No wonder it was going mad, this idiot stole its child and was even holding a sword in front of its neck. This fucking idiot was ruining everything. I just let it run at Nathan without a care since at least then he would stop ruining shit and getting in the way.
The Mayor didn’t like that though and ran straight in front of Nathan ready to let himself die as long as Nathan lived. Nathan didn’t even try and stop the Mayor, he just stood there with shock for a second then went back to a normal expression.
Now I was mad since this guy wasn’t even surprised. He was gonna let someone die for him without a care. Probably promise to do what the Mayor's last words were then not do it. I sent a root powered by Wind Magic towards the Mayor and pulled him out of the way just in time. He did get his leg ripped off but at least he wasn’t dead. I couldn’t say the same for Nathan though, he was thrown 10 feet away and his whole body was mangled. I didn’t care though since if he didn’t die from that then my poison was gonna finish him.
The bear was in a weakened state after going berserk and using all its energy on that one move. It was laying on the ground with its baby resting on its stomach. I was in a dilemma now since I didn’t want to kill the bear but then again all that Mana. I couldn’t kill it after knowing it had kids and was willing to die for them, it was just out of my nature as a tree.
I decided not to kill the bear and let it live. I do know Nathan is still alive though since he was breathing. I threw him in the [Root Prison] then sucked out all the Mana the system gave him to survive. He had broken through to Normal Tier Magic Rank and I was taking all the Mana away to return him to 1st Rank Spirit. I broke through using all that Mana and even had a little extra so I gave it to the Mayor since he did help. His injuries had healed and he was doing okay now.
He looked at Nathan and just sighed. He had seen the expression that Nathan had when he was about to sacrifice himself. He realized that Nathan didn’t care about anyone but himself. He turned around and bowed to me, “Thank you…”
‘Naen’ I said while projecting my humanoid image into his head.
“Thank you Naen for helping me, this has shown me something that finally broke the mental barrier I had. Now I can finally breakthrough.” He bowed again gave one last look at the bear then grabbed Nathans's mangled body from the [Root Prison] like it was a rag doll then zoomed away.
I guess he can be a long-term ally.
